I'm a DBA and used to work for a Tax Software and Law Enforcement systems company in North Texas.
I can tell you most PDs and SOs systems track every query a user does by unique user id and machine/ip used to execute the query.

What you mentioned is the exact reason that stuff is tracked now.

I know for a FACT BRPD officers can't just willie nillie do searches on that kind of shite without reason.
